1. Modern classification of endopathologies
  • Clinical and radiological signs.
  • Comparison of WHO and AAE classifications.
  • Determination of tooth vitality and its verification (from the cold test to the Doppler effect).
  • Impact on the forecast.
2. Radiology
  • Conventional images (recommendations on the process of development and storage).
  • An overview of digital direct and indirect methods.
  • Factors affecting the reading of snapshots.
  • Correlation (or lack thereof) of radiological features and histological reality.
  • Bite shots in everyday practice.
  • Cone beam computed tomography in endodontics.
  • Radiology at all stages of endodontic treatment from diagnosis to follow-up (when, how, and how much).
3. Determination of the working length
  • Apex anatomy: Apical constriction, Major foramen, CDJ, Anatomical apex (apical constriction, large opening, cement-dentine junction,anatomical apex)
  • Theories of apical patency and apical scarp: pros and cons.
  • Methods for determining the working length:
    • X-ray image with a tool (referencepoint).
    • Tactile method.
    • Paper rounds.
    • Apexlocators (RootZX, Root ZX mini, APIT7, Bingo-1020, NovApex,BingoPro, XFR, Propex, Propex 2, Raypex-4, Raypex-5,Raypex-6, I-PEX).
    • Combined motors and apexlocators (TriAutoZX, Dentaport ZX,Gold,X-smart Dual,Rider).
4. Irrigation in endodontics
  • NaOCl (sodium hypochlorite), CHX (chlorhexidine), Alexidine, EDTA (EDTA), Citric acid, H2O2 (hydrogen peroxide), MTAD (MTAD),Qmix.
  • Mechanisms of action, methods of use, recommended concentrations, interactions, advantages and disadvantages, possible complications and clinical choice.
  • Irrigation techniques: dynamic, aspiration, sonic, ultrasound (EndoVac, RinseEndo, EndoActivator, PlasticEndo, QuantecE, PUI (Endosoft, Irisafe).
5. Smear layer
  • Structure, origin, removal, effect on endodontic treatment.
  • The author's algorithm of clinical solutions
6. Lubricants in endodontics - a critical analysis
  • Physics, chemistry, microbiology and mechanics - what is
7. Intra-channel medications.
  • Ca(OH)2 (calcium hydroxide): Calxyl, Pulpodent, Tempcanal, Cavital, Reogan, Calasept, Hypocal Calen, and others.
  • Iodoform (iodoform): Metapex, Vitapex, Endoflass.
  • Ledermix (ledermix).
  • CHX (chlorhexidine).
  • Mechanisms of action, recommended concentrations, interactions, recommended timing and methods of use, clinical choice.
8. Silers in endodontics
A detailed analysis of all groups, their properties, advantages and disadvantages, and techniques of use.
  • ZnOE (zinc oxide-eugenol): Kerr cement, Roth's cement, ProcoSOL, Tubliseal, Pulp Canal Sealer.
  • Ca(OH)2 (calcium hydroxide): APEXIT, SEALAPEX, CRSC, Acroseal.
  • Полимеры (полимеры): Endorez, AH 26, AH+, 2Seal, Adseal, MMSeal, Diaket, Roekoseal.
  • GIC (glass ionomers): Ketacendo, ZUT.
  • The "damn" endometason.
  • MTA and Ceramic sealer (MTA FILLAPEX, Endo CMP sealer, BC Sealer)
9. Gutta-percha. Composition, physical forms.
The main advantages and disadvantages.
10. Rezilon / epiphany as a monoblock attempt.
  • Composition, characteristics, methods of work, analysis of modern literature, critical analysis.
11. Recommended minimum tools.
  • DG 16
  • Long Neck Burs
  • Front Surface
  • Ruler-ring
  • RubberDum (selection of clamps, work options)
12. Pharmacology in endodontics
Analysis of groups of drugs, their actions, current indications and recommended use options and doses.
  • Antibiotics (penicillins, nitroimidazoles, lincosamides).
  • Painkillers (NSAIDs – salicylic acid derivatives, COX 2 selective –selective COX-2 inhibitors, Paracetamol- paracetamol, Steroid- corticosteroids).
  • When, doses, contraindications, allergies
13. First aid in endodontics
  • Hypochlorite accident
  • Symptomatic pulpitis.
  • Acute abscess
  • Algorithm of clinical actions and pharmacological support
